2 shot by gunman outside Airbnb rental-house party

Two men shot at NYC birthday party

NEW YORK -- Two men were shot at a house party in New York City early Sunday morning, and police are searching for the shooter, reports CBS New York.

Police questioned witnesses and searched for evidence for hours Sunday, in front of the large home in Queens.

Authorities said the home was being rented out for a birthday party. It was previously advertised for rent on the website Airbnb, where it was offered for $500 per night. Neighbors said the owners routinely rented out the house.

When the soon-to-be victims left the party Sunday, there was an argument, police said. Then a man walked up, opened fire and fled, cops said.

Both victims were wounded in their torsos, according to police. A 27-year-old man is in critical condition. A 23-year-old man is in stable condition.

Police have not released a description of the suspected gunman.

The house sold in 2006 for $1.8 million.

The Daily News reports that people paid between $15 and $25 to enter the party, according to witnesses, and organizers hired hired security for the event. Party-goers younger than 21 were reportedly restricted from entering an area where alcohol was served.
